Programme Manager - East Midlands

Shannon Trust | Derby | Permanent | Full-time | £36,050/year | www.charityjob.co.uk |
Programme Manager - East Midlands

Location: Derby
Salary: £36,050 FTE
Hours: 35 hours per week
Department: Prison delivery
Job Type: Full time
Contract Type: Permanent

Benefits: Standard Shannon Trust: Employee benefits include a company contribution to pension scheme of up to 5%, 30 days holiday plus bank holidays, life insurance, paid volunteering days, discounts via Reward Gateway and an Employee Assistance Programme.

Do you want to join an organisation committed to addressing low literacy and numeracy levels amongst people in prison?

Our three year strategy is working well with improvements and expansions to our delivery model, a renewed vision and mission and we want to continue to develop and grow. To support this, we are recruiting for a new programme manager to grow our programmes and contracts in our East Midlands region.
Our East Midlands area covers prisons such as HMP Foston Hall, HMP Leicester, HMP Whatton, HMP Gartree, HMP Lowdham Grange, HMP Sudbury, HMP Fosse Way, HMP Morton Hall, HMP North Sea Camp, HMP Peterborough and HMP Five Wells. We are seeking proactive, committed, and enthusiastic applicants to join our team and help us continue our journey.

Working closely with people in prison, prison managers, Shannon Trust staff and volunteers you will ensure development of our criminal programmes maximising literacy and numeracy learning opportunities for people across a number of prisons and contracts in your area. 

Ideally you will have some experience of prison settings, managing teams and contract performance, underpinned by the ability to build relationships and personal qualities that include resilience, determination and a problem-solving approach.
We want to hear from applicants who can lead, drive performance and who are as committed to the cause as we are.

This is a home-based role but does require travel across our central region and some work based onsite in the prisons. 
Employee benefits include a company contribution to pension scheme of up to 5%, 30 days holiday plus bank holidays, life insurance, paid volunteering days, discounts via Reward Gateway and an Employee Assistance Programme. The biggest benefit though is our culture – our people really want to work for the organisation.

We welcome job applications from people with lived experience of the criminal justice system and do not routinely ask for details of any criminal convictions. These roles do require prison security clearance, so we will need to ask for details of any relevant criminal convictions before an offer of employment is finalised.
